#ff9562 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ff9562 is composed of 100% red, 58.4%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.6% magenta, 61.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 19.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 69.2%. #ff9562 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#ff2b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#ff9562 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ff9562 has RGB values of R:255, G:149,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.62, K:0. Its decimal value is 16749922.
